Court Theatre Fund

The Court Theatre Fund, designated by the EIN 36-3203660, is a nonprofit organization within the United States, classified under the Arts, Culture and Humanities category, specifically as a Single Organization Support entity as per the National Taxonomy of Exempt Entities (NTEE)[1].

Purpose and Activities

The Court Theatre Fund supports the operations of Court Theatre, a department of the University of Chicago[5]. Court Theatre is a nonprofit arts organization that focuses on staging plays of enduring relevance, enhancing its reputation both in Chicago and nationwide. The theatre's work is supported by ticket sales, subscriptions, and donations, which facilitate productions, an Education Initiative, and community outreach programs[2][3].

Financial Operations

Financial data indicates that the Court Theatre Fund has historically reported minimal to no revenues from typical sources such as contributions, program services, investment income, fundraising, or asset sales[1]. Despite this, it has maintained minimal assets and no liabilities over various fiscal years[1].

As we celebrate the Closing of BERLIN, it’s only fitting that we also celebrate the conclusion of BERLIN’s public programs. This suite of programs was expansive, multidisciplinary, and full of defiant joy. In just a few weeks, we collaborated on a curated tour of Potential Energy: Chicago Puppets Up Close, an Agora about Resistance & Resilience, a book signing and conversation with graphic novelist Jason Lutes (author of BERLIN), a communal arts activation, a post-show discussion, a film screening, and a drag king and burlesque show.
